On March 31, 2026, the US trade chief criticized the World Trade Organization (WTO) for its failure to achieve consensus regarding a crucial e-commerce moratorium.

This critique highlights concerns over the WTO's effectiveness in facilitating global trade discussions, particularly in the rapidly evolving digital economy.

The US official indicated a perception of a limited role for the WTO moving forward, which may influence future trade negotiations and international cooperation on e-commerce regulations.
